Prerequisites
STEP 1: Download the software here.
STEP 2: Extract/ execute the Installer, signed by Definitive Data Security, Inc.
STEP 3: If prompted to Reboot, you must do so for proper operation.
Provision your First Test Account
STEP 4: Double-click the Desktop SSProtect Shortcut -OR- right-click the SSProtect icon in the notification tray then choose Refresh Login. Both display the Login dialog:
STEP 5: Click the Profile dropdown and choose, Create New... to display the Create Account dialog.
STEP 6: Check :Recover and :Email but do NOT check Org, then enter the Email Address of the Test Account you will use.
NOTE: We strongly encourage the use of a single Gmail address using aliases for this and the subsequent Accounts we create and use throughout this series.
STEP 7: Click Create... to continue.
STEP 8: Check your email for the message Subject, [SSProtect] Create Account from ssp-admin@definisec.com (slightly different here). This message includes the Code you need:
STEP 9: Enter the Code, from the email message, into the Code edit box of your Create Account dialog, as shown below. Continue with Verify:*
STEP 10: Create/ enter your New Pwd (twice) for this Account - you will use this to Login to SSProtect. Click Change to Provision:*
* Your Server designation will be ssp.secdefini.com or similar, rather than the non-public instance noted for our team's internal use.
1st Time Use Progression
This sequence represents 1st Time Use as described in the linked article, specific to your Test Account.
STEP 11: You will be prompted to set your Default Folder, the default for Reports, exported Key Files, and a location that can be remapped when using your Test Account on other host computers. Choose Yes:
STEP 12: Browse to/ create C:\TestData (aligns w/ subsequent Walkthroughs), choose Select Folder.
STEP 13: You will be prompted to Export Account Keys, which as an Individual Account you MUST do. Choose Yes to proceed:
STEP 14: Create/ enter a Password (and Confirmed value) for the Key File, different from your Login, then OK to finish.
STEP 15: You will then be prompted to install the :Email Add-In for Microsoft Outlook. Choose Yes.
